原文:ThinkPHP5中如何實現模板完全靜態化

模板完全靜態化,也就是通過模板完全生成純靜態的網頁,相比動態頁面和偽靜態頁面更安全更利於SEO訪問更快。相比前二者各有利弊吧,現在稍微對這三種形式的優缺點對比一下,以及在ThinkPHP 項目中實現完全靜態化的基本過程。 對比 . 動態與真靜態 頁面靜態化與動態頁的對比,靜態沒有了SQL和一些后端腳本運行,安全穩定,訪問速度快,對SEO友好 網上也有說現在的搜索引擎已經對動態網頁的抓取沒什么壓力 ...

2019-10-11 09:19 0 1022 推薦指數:

查看詳情

thinkphp5 模板輸出當前時間

{$data.time|default=time()|date='Y-m-d H:i:s',###} -------------------------- {:time()} //為輸出當前時間 ...

Fri Dec 27 23:21:00 CST 2019 0 3180
Thinkphp5模板繼承

代碼 application\index\controller\index.php 模板application\index\view\index\index.html 模板application\index\view\index\base.html ...

Fri Jul 07 01:22:00 CST 2017 0 3005
Thinkphp5 實現動態模板主題多個模板切換

在項目開發過程中會遇到一個網站有不同風格,本文詳細介紹Thinkphp5 實現模板主題多個模板切換 一、在Config配置view_path模板路徑代碼如下 1 2 3 ...

Fri Dec 20 07:50:00 CST 2019 0 1397
Thinkphp5 實現動態模板主題多個模板切換

在項目開發過程中會遇到一個網站有不同風格,本文詳細介紹Thinkphp5 實現模板主題多個模板切換 一、在Config配置view_path模板路徑代碼如下 'template' => [ // 模板引擎類型 支持 ...

Wed Jan 24 19:05:00 CST 2018 0 4213
ThinkPHP5入門(四)----模板

一、模板訪問 1、沒有參數傳遞 此時默認訪問的模板路徑為:[模板文件目錄]/當前控制器名(小寫+下划線)/當前操作名(小寫).html 2、指定模板(跨模板) 此時訪問的模板路徑為:[模板文件目錄]/當前控制器名(小寫 ...

Mon Mar 26 07:26:00 CST 2018 0 1057
thinkphp5 分頁實現

ThinkPHP5.0內置了分頁實現,要給數據添加分頁輸出功能在5.0變得非常簡單,可以直接在Db類查詢的時候調用paginate方法: 也可以改成模型的分頁查詢代碼: 模板文件中分頁輸出代碼如下: 也可以單獨賦值分頁輸出的模板變量 模板文件中分頁輸出代碼如下: 默認 ...

Tue Jun 27 19:52:00 CST 2017 0 3342
基於 ThinkPHP 3.2.3 的頁面靜態功能的實現

PHP 的頁面靜態有多種實現方式,比如使用輸出緩沖(output buffering),該種方式是把數據緩存在 PHP 的緩沖區(內存),下一次取數據時直接從緩沖區讀取數據,從而避免了腳本的編譯和訪問數據庫等過程;另一種方式是直接生成靜態的 HTML 文件,使用文件讀寫函數來實現,一些內容 ...

Sat Dec 26 20:19:00 CST 2015 0 7690
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M